(04-28-2021, 09:32 PM)NATI BENGALS Wrote: Thanks Lapham for giving our pick away that year

The Bengals put themselves behind the Lions with the Glenn trade. Less than two weeks later, the Lions watched their starting center sign elsewhere. If anything, blame the Cowboys. They took Vander Esch, who the Lions really wanted. Sadly, the Bengals had no shot at Ragnow after the trade down. Plus, a lot of media members have mentioned that the Bengals also thought very highly of Vander Esch and were a darkhorse team to draft him.
